The moment I installed the WD_BLACK SN850P into my PS5, I knew why Reddit users call M.2 SSD expansion the number one must-have upgrade. With the base console offering limited storage, constantly deleting and re-downloading games becomes exhausting. This drive eliminates that problem entirely.
What sets the SN850P apart is its official PlayStation 5 licensing. That badge means zero compatibility guesswork. You slot it in, close the cover, and the console recognizes it immediately. No firmware conflicts, no speed concerns, no headaches.

Read Speeds and Real-World Load Times
WD_BLACK rates this drive at 7,300MB/s sequential read speeds, and our testing confirmed those numbers hold up. Games load noticeably faster compared to the internal storage, especially open-world titles like Spider-Man 2 and Final Fantasy XVI.
The PCIe Gen 4 technology ensures you are getting current-generation performance. During extended gaming sessions, the optimized heatsink keeps temperatures well within safe ranges. We monitored thermals over a 4-hour session and saw zero thermal throttling.

Installation and PS5 Compatibility
Installation took roughly five minutes. You unscrew the PS5 expansion slot cover, remove a retention screw, slot the drive in, and re-secure it. The included heatsink fits perfectly within Sony’s specified dimensions for all PS5 models including PS5 Pro and PS5 Slim.
With 1TB of additional space, you can store roughly 200 games depending on file sizes. The drive supports playing directly from it, meaning no transfers or deletions needed. It just works as an extension of your main storage.
Value and Long-Term Reliability
The 5-year limited warranty provides serious peace of mind. WD_BLACK stands behind this product with a TBW (terabytes written) rating that exceeds what most gamers will write in a decade of use. Over 11,000 Amazon reviewers have given it a 4.8-star average, with 91 percent awarding five stars.
Is it more expensive than some non-licensed alternatives? Yes. But the official PS5 licensing, proven reliability, and included heatsink make it worth every penny for anyone serious about their gaming library.

The Samsung 990 PRO with Heatsink is the speed king of PS5-compatible SSDs. If you want the absolute fastest storage expansion money can buy, this is it. Our team has used Samsung PRO drives for years across multiple consoles and PCs, and the reliability has been flawless.
Samsung claims 40 percent faster random read and 55 percent faster random write speeds compared to the previous 980 PRO generation. Those numbers translate to snappier game loads and smoother asset streaming in demanding titles.

Speed Benchmarks Against the Competition
The 990 PRO hits 7,450MB/s sequential read and 6,900MB/s sequential write speeds. That edges out the WD_BLACK SN850P by a small margin. In practice, both drives feel equally fast during gameplay, but the Samsung pulls ahead in heavy file transfer scenarios.
The nickel-coated high-end controller and Samsung V-NAND flash technology work together to sustain peak performance. Unlike cheaper drives that slow down after a few minutes of heavy use, the 990 PRO maintains its rated speeds consistently.
Thermal Management and PS5 Fit
The built-in heatsink is critical for PS5 use. Sony requires any M.2 SSD without a heatsink to have one installed separately. The 990 PRO comes ready to go, and the heatsink fits perfectly inside the PS5 expansion bay for all console models including PS5 Slim and PS5 Pro.
During our testing, drive temperatures never exceeded safe operating ranges even during 6-hour gaming marathons. The thermal control is noticeably better than some third-party heatsink add-ons we have tried on other drives.

Warranty and Samsung Magician Software
The 5-year manufacturer warranty matches what WD_BLACK offers. Samsung also provides their Magician software for PC users who want to monitor drive health, though PS5 users will rely on the console’s built-in storage management. Over 5,000 Amazon reviewers give it a 4.7-star average rating.
If budget is not a concern and you want the absolute fastest PS5 storage expansion available, the Samsung 990 PRO is the answer. The speed difference over the SN850P is measurable, even if it is not always perceptible during gameplay.

The DualSense Edge is Sony’s answer to the Xbox Elite controller, and after weeks of testing, I can confirm it delivers. This is the $200 PS5 controller that people ask about, and it earns that price tag through genuine competitive advantages for serious players.
From the moment you pick it up, the premium feel is unmistakable. The leathery texture on the grips provides confident handling during intense sessions. Every component feels engineered for precision and longevity.

Mappable Back Buttons and Paddle Customization
The four metal paddles on the back are the headline feature. You can map any button to these paddles, meaning your thumbs never need to leave the analog sticks during gameplay. For FPS games like Call of Duty, this translates directly to better aim and faster reactions.
Profile switching is handled via dedicated FN buttons on the underside. You can create separate profiles for different games and switch between them instantly. This is particularly useful if you play both competitive shooters and story-driven adventures with different control preferences.
Replaceable Stick Modules and Drift Solution
Stick drift is the plague of modern controllers. The DualSense Edge solves this by making the stick modules replaceable. When drift eventually develops, you swap the module for a fresh one instead of buying an entire new controller. That $20 replacement saves you from a $200 repurchase.
The included stick caps come in multiple heights and shapes. You get standard, high-rise, and dome options to match your grip style and game type. For players with smaller hands, the low-profile caps make the controller significantly more comfortable.

Trigger Sensitivity and Competitive Edge
The adjustable trigger stops let you reduce trigger travel distance for faster inputs. In FPS games where milliseconds matter, shaving trigger pull time gives a measurable advantage. You can also adjust stick response curves to fine-tune aiming sensitivity.
The included hardshell carrying case is surprisingly well-made. It holds the controller, spare stick modules, braided USB-C cable, and paddle attachments securely. For tournament players or those who travel with their setup, this case alone justifies part of the price.
Battery Life Trade-offs
The one significant drawback is battery life. The Edge drains faster than the standard DualSense due to the additional processing for customization features. Expect roughly 4 to 6 hours per charge depending on rumble and trigger usage intensity.
This is where a good charging station becomes essential. If you invest in the DualSense Edge, pairing it with a dual charging dock ensures you always have power ready. Despite the battery concern, over 1,600 reviewers give it a 4.6-star average with 84 percent five-star ratings.

The DualSense Wireless Controller in Starlight Blue is proof that sometimes the stock option is the best option. This controller ships with all the features that make PS5 gaming special, and the Starlight Blue colorway adds personality without the premium price of the Edge.
If you need a second controller for local multiplayer or want a backup when your primary runs out of battery, this is the pick. The color is vibrant in person and photographs beautifully for anyone who shares their gaming setup on social media.

Haptic Feedback and Adaptive Triggers
The haptic feedback system is what separates the DualSense from every other controller on the market. Games like Astro’s Playroom and Returnal demonstrate this technology brilliantly, with sensations ranging from subtle raindrops to the tension of drawing a bowstring.
Adaptive triggers add resistance that changes based on in-game actions. Drawing a bow feels different from firing a machine gun, and crashing a car produces a distinct trigger kick. Not every game takes advantage of these features, but those that do create experiences impossible on any other platform.
Build Quality and Comfort
The evolved design fits naturally in the hands during extended sessions. The textured grips provide secure handling, and the button layout will feel familiar to anyone who has used a DualShock 4. The built-in microphone is surprisingly usable for quick voice chat when you do not have a headset handy.
The Create button replaces the old Share button and adds recording and broadcasting capabilities. The 3.5mm headset jack on the bottom means you can use wired headphones without an adapter. Over 12,000 reviewers give this controller a 4.7-star average with 88 percent five-star ratings.

Durability Concerns and Stick Drift
The most common complaint across long-term reviews is stick drift developing after extended use. This is an industry-wide issue with Hall-effect sensor controllers, not unique to the DualSense. Sony’s 1-year warranty covers this, and the Starlight Blue variant has the same internal components as the white version.
Battery life averages 6 to 8 hours depending on haptic intensity and trigger usage. For most gaming sessions, this is sufficient, but competitive players should keep a charging station nearby. The USB-C charging port means you can top up quickly between sessions.

The Razer BlackShark V2 X proves you do not need to spend hundreds for quality PS5 audio. At its price point, this headset delivers sound quality that punches well above its weight. Our team was genuinely surprised by how good games sounded through these drivers.
The TRIFORCE TITANIUM 50mm drivers separate highs, mids, and lows into individually tuned chambers. This design produces clearer audio than many headsets costing twice as much. Footsteps in FPS games are distinct and directional, which gives you a competitive advantage.

Comfort for Marathon Gaming Sessions
At just 240 grams, this is one of the lightest gaming headsets available. The memory foam ear cushions with leatherette covering create a comfortable seal that blocks outside noise passively. I wore these for a 5-hour session without any ear fatigue or pressure points.
The closed-earcup design provides advanced passive noise cancellation. While it is not active noise cancellation like premium wireless headsets, the seal is effective enough to block most ambient room noise. For PS5 gaming in a shared household, this makes a real difference.
Microphone Quality and Console Performance
The HyperClear cardioid microphone uses an improved pickup pattern that focuses on your voice and rejects background noise. Teammates reported clear, natural voice reproduction during multiplayer sessions. The mic is fixed but flexible, bending to the exact position you need.

Connectivity and Compatibility Notes
The 3.5mm jack connects directly to the DualSense controller, which means zero latency and no battery to charge. This is both the headset’s strength and limitation. You get reliable wired audio, but you are tethered to your controller.
The 7.1 virtual surround sound feature works on PC through Razer Synapse software but is limited on PS5. The console’s built-in Tempest 3D Audio handles spatial sound processing, which actually works well with this headset’s capable drivers. Over 28,000 Amazon reviewers give it a 4.4-star average.

The Logitech G29 Driving Force Racing Wheel transforms racing games on PS5. If you play Gran Turismo 7, F1, or any serious racing title, a controller simply cannot replicate the experience of force feedback through a leather-wrapped wheel. This is the entry point to proper sim racing.
Logitech has dominated the console racing wheel market for years, and the G29 represents their proven formula. The hand-stitched leather cover feels premium, the force feedback is convincing, and the build quality has earned trust across over 43,000 Amazon reviews.

Force Feedback and Driving Realism
The force feedback system translates in-game physics into physical resistance through the wheel. You feel every curb, slip, and traction loss. In Gran Turismo 7, this means you can sense when your rear tires are about to break loose before it happens visually.
The helical gearing system provides smooth, quiet steering without the notchy feel of cheaper gear-driven wheels. The 900-degree lock-to-lock rotation matches real passenger cars, meaning you turn the wheel the same amount you would in a real vehicle. This authenticity is what separates racing wheels from controllers.
Pedals and Build Construction
The included floor pedals feature pressure-sensitive nonlinear brake response. This mimics real brake pedal behavior where initial travel is soft before firms up as you brake harder. The pedal base is sturdy enough to stay planted on carpet, though a racing rig provides the best experience.

Compatibility and Value Assessment
The G29 works with PS5, PS4, PC, and Mac, giving you flexibility across platforms. The 16 programmable buttons on the wheel face provide access to all essential controls without reaching for a separate device. Stainless steel paddle shifters provide satisfying tactile feedback during gear changes.
As an entry-level force feedback wheel, the G29 is not designed for hardcore sim racing enthusiasts who want direct-drive technology. But for PS5 owners who want to dramatically improve their racing game experience without spending thousands, it hits the sweet spot. Over 43,000 reviewers give it a 4.6-star average, confirming its status as the most popular PS5 racing wheel available.
How to Choose the Best PS5 Accessories for Your Setup
Building the right PS5 accessory collection depends on your gaming habits, budget, and console model. This buying guide walks through the key decisions to help you spend wisely and avoid accessories that do not deliver value.
Console Model Compatibility: PS5 vs PS5 Pro vs PS5 Slim
The first consideration is which PS5 model you own. All accessories on this list work with the original PS5, but PS5 Slim and PS5 Pro have slight physical differences that matter. The PS5 Slim has a smaller footprint and different side panel mechanism, which affects stands and faceplates.
M.2 SSDs are compatible across all three models since the expansion slot specifications are identical. Controllers, charging stations, headsets, and media remotes work universally. The main compatibility concerns are physical accessories like stands and cooling stations that are molded to the console’s dimensions.
Storage Expansion: What Specs Matter
For PS5 SSD expansion, Sony requires PCIe Gen 4 NVMe drives with read speeds of 5,500MB/s or faster. Both the WD_BLACK SN850P (7,300MB/s) and Samsung 990 PRO (7,450MB/s) exceed this requirement comfortably. A heatsink is mandatory, and both drives include one.
Capacity is a personal decision. 1TB adds roughly 200 games of storage, which satisfies most users. If you maintain a massive game library, consider 2TB or 4TB variants of the same drives. The installation process is identical regardless of capacity.
Controller Upgrades: Standard vs Pro
Deciding between a second standard DualSense and the DualSense Edge comes down to gaming intensity. Casual players benefit more from a second standard controller for local multiplayer. Competitive players who main FPS or fighting games will appreciate the Edge’s customizable paddles and trigger stops.
Budget-conscious players should consider the standard DualSense plus KontolFreek thumbsticks. This combination costs roughly half the Edge’s price while delivering meaningful aim improvement. The Edge’s replaceable stick modules make it more economical long-term if you experience repeated drift.
Audio Solutions: Wired vs Wireless Considerations
The Razer BlackShark V2 X offers excellent wired audio through the DualSense 3.5mm jack. For wireless freedom, consider upgrading to a wireless headset in a higher price tier. The PS5’s Tempest 3D Audio works with any quality headset, so the audio processing is handled by the console regardless of your choice.
Wired headsets have zero latency and never need charging. Wireless headsets offer freedom of movement and often include features like active noise cancellation. Your gaming environment and preferences determine which trade-off works best.
Charging Strategy: Dock vs Stand
If you only need controller charging, the PowerA Twin Charging Station or Svetaecho dock are ideal. If you want a complete console management solution with cooling, storage, and multiple charging ports, the OIVO all-in-one stand is the better choice.
Reddit users consistently identify charging stations as the number one must-have accessory. The convenience of always having charged controllers ready cannot be overstated. Even the cheapest option on this list eliminates the dead-controller-mid-game problem entirely.
Budget Allocation Tips from Real Gamers
Forum insights from r/PS5 reveal that experienced users recommend prioritizing storage expansion and a charging station first. These two categories solve the most common daily frustrations. Audio upgrades and controller customization come next, followed by specialized accessories like racing wheels and media remotes.
For budget-conscious buyers, spending on SSD plus a budget charging dock covers the essentials for under $250. The remaining accessories can be added over time as budget allows. This phased approach ensures you address the most impactful upgrades first.

What is the $200 PS5 controller called?
The $200 PS5 controller is called the PlayStation DualSense Edge. It features mappable back paddles, replaceable stick modules, adjustable trigger sensitivity, interchangeable stick caps, and includes a premium hardshell carrying case. It is Sony’s premium pro controller designed for competitive gaming.

Is it better to stand your PlayStation 5 up or lay it down?
Sony designed the PS5 to work in both vertical and horizontal orientations with no performance difference. Vertical orientation saves desk space and allows better airflow on some surfaces. Horizontal orientation provides more stability and is preferred when using stands with cooling fans like the OIVO. Choose based on your entertainment center layout.
What PS5 accessories are actually worth buying?
Based on user reviews and forum consensus, the most worthwhile PS5 accessories are an M.2 SSD for storage expansion, a dual controller charging station, and a quality gaming headset. These three upgrades address the biggest daily frustrations: limited storage, dead controllers, and poor audio. Racing wheels and pro controllers are worth it only for enthusiasts in those categories.
Do PS5 accessories work with PS5 Pro and PS5 Slim?
Most PS5 accessories work across all three console models. Controllers, charging stations, headsets, media remotes, and M.2 SSDs are fully compatible with PS5, PS5 Pro, and PS5 Slim. The main exceptions are physical accessories like console stands and faceplates, which are molded to specific console dimensions and may not fit the Slim or Pro models.
